Product snapshot
AirDroid Remote Access is a cross-platform web tool for managing mobile and other endpoints from afar. It combines centralized controls with lightweight client features so organizations and individual users can monitor, control, and maintain devices without being physically present.
Capabilities for organizations
- Device tracking and persistent location updates to help monitor assets in the field
- Location-triggered rules (geofencing) for automated responses when a device enters or leaves defined zones
- App lifecycle and policy management for deploying, updating, or restricting applications remotely
- Locked-down kiosk environments for single-use or public-facing devices
Operational security and automation
The platform enforces configurable security policies and supports workflow automation to reduce manual tasks. These controls help maintain compliance, speed up routine operations, and improve resilience so business processes continue with minimal disruption.
Features geared toward individuals and small teams
- Parental controls to supervise and limit a child’s device activities
- Screen-mirroring and casting (AirDroid Cast) for presentations or tutoring across Android and iOS
- Black-screen privacy mode to obscure the remote display during sessions
- Fast file transfers between devices for sharing documents or media
- Real-time screen sharing for troubleshooting or demos
- Compact device management utilities for quick status checks and settings changes
- Remote-control access to operate a device as if it were in hand
Collaboration and privacy notes
AirDroid supports collaborative use cases such as remote support and screen sharing while offering options (like black-screen sessions and policy enforcement) to protect sensitive information during remote interactions.
